    Mark, I just went through the update recently. The latest version is 1.25.

    See here for instructions on finding the version in your camera: https://forums.creativecow.net/thread/142/870911#870925

    See here for my update experience, as well as arguments for not doing it yourself; https://forums.creativecow.net/thread/142/873861#873861

    With respect to the OP, I’ve successfully used a 32gb SanDisk Extreme class 10 card and Hoodman Raw SxS adapter without issues. Caviat; I haven’t used it a lot; actually have not filled the card yet or over-cranked with it.
